Gepp Solicitors is looking for a Probate Executive to join their Private Client Department in Chelmsford. In this hybrid role, you will:
- Draft inheritance tax forms
- Assist with estate administration
- Liaise with clients and HMRC
The successful candidate will have a keen eye for detail, enjoy teamwork, and be motivated to learn. The firm offers competitive salaries, life assurance, and a health cash plan among other benefits.
